Question : The percentage marks obtained by 6 students in different subjects are given below. The maximum marks for each subject have been indicated in the table.
| Subject Students |
Physics | Mathematics | Hindi | Geography | English | History |
| Maximum Marks→ |
80 | 150 | 100 | 75 | 120 | 50 |
|
P Q R S T U
|
70 90 85 75 65 60
|
44 40 32 70 60 50
|
88 54 70 58 45 60
|
88 92 64 80 88 72
|
70 65 55 60 50 25
|
38 40 30 35 42 48
|
The total marks obtained by student Q in Physics and Hindi are what percentage (rounded off to the nearest integer) more than the total marks obtained by student T in Geography and History?
Option 1: 45%
Option 2: 49%
Option 3: 56%
Option 4: 38%
Correct Answer: 45%
Solution :
The total marks obtained by student Q in Physics and Hindi:
In Physics, student Q scored 90% of 80 marks = 0.9 × 80 = 72 marks
In Hindi, student Q scored 54% of 100 marks = 0.54 × 100 = 54 marks
So, the total marks obtained by student Q in Physics and Hindi = 72 + 54 = 126 marks
The total marks obtained by student T in Geography and History:
In Geography, student T scored 88% of 75 marks = 0.88 × 75 = 66 marks
In History, student T scored 42% of 50 marks = 0.42 × 50 = 21 marks
So, the total marks obtained by student T in Geography and History = 66 + 21 = 87 marks
Required percentage
$= \frac{\text{Total marks by Q in Physics and Hindi} - \text{Total marks by T in History and Geography}}{\text{Total marks by T in History and Geography}} \times 100$
$= \frac{126 - 87}{87} \times 100$
$ = 44.83\approx45$%
Hence, the correct answer is 45%.
